Truth Matters: 11 22 21

Truth Matters / Dr. Cheryl Davis
The Truth Network Radio
November 22, 2021 9:47 am

Truth Matters: 11 22 21

Truth Matters / Dr. Cheryl Davis

This is proof letters daily devotion, Dr. Cheryl Davis matters is a ministry project whose mission is to empower men and women in the Christian faith to teach biblical truth in the culture of the marketplace of ideas using the Bible as a sacred trust of truth in sharing the message of Jesus. Learn more about the ministry of the current project at for picking off a new week with details on the war between Heaven and Satan is a hoax.

I'm Dr. Cheryl Davison, you are listening to truth matters.

The war in heaven is a continuation of the war that has been going on for ages between God and Satan. The war breaks out in heaven during the tribulation.

This is a war between Michael God's angel and Satan see this for the future of the wars going on right now as we speak. In heaven, but the best place to learn about this is Daniel. Chapter 10 months ago.

You know we did the book of Daniel before we got into the series and I will miss Ellie got back to Daniel. Chapter 10 because I know you been following Daniel series, as well as Revelation, but chapter 10 of Daniel. He's in captivity he's made a request to God in prayer to summarize it for us.

He received no answer to his prayers for 21 days in spite of fasting morning. But on the 24th day is told by an emissary from heaven that the answer to his prayer was delayed due to the opposition from the Prince of Persia and that is in Daniel chapter 10 verse 13 and I'll just read that really quickly but the prince of the kingdom of Persia withstood me 21 days and held my: the chief princes, came to help me. I had been left alone there with the kings person's answer only came through as a result of the assistance furnished by Michael, one of the chief princes want to say is that you know we think allow the signs or abstractor that are theoretical. But this war is not abstract or theoretical is concrete in real evil has a personality as did his angels, and they use their personalities to influence the personalities of earthly rulers to accomplish their desires.

Just as God will one day punish earthly will rulers for their sin. He intends to punish angelic influencers say, we see that Isaiah chapter 24 verse 21 and it shall come to pass in that day that the Lord will punish on high. The host of exhausted ones and on the earth. The kings of the earth really want is on this war even exist. You know if we've established that the worst thing going on since Genesis chapter 3 what is spiritual warfare even exist if Christ defeated Satan at the cross, then why is he still the prince of this world you know that is a breach of question and when going through this in our class is real valid questions you have. Why, why was in the Senate carried out for Satan immediately, unmistakably, Satan was defeated in the crosswise you know why is he still roaming around in seems like he's in control and why is he of appointive prominence being the prince of this world, but to be honest to me. Think about it on Satan appears to have more freedom than we think you should know really when I think of Satan being defeated.

I don't know why he still able to influence the way that he does and why humans are following such prey to them even more so in these last days on, we know that Jesus died on the cross and defeated Satan but really for a long time. I really didn't get this didn't understand until I really got into studying Revelation fully understand it the best way to understand this disconnect is to remember that the cross was first and foremost a legal transaction cost was first and foremost a legal transaction on Christ appease the wrath of God and satisfies his justice with his blood as a sacrifice which was foreshadowed by the sacrificial system given with the law, but because of this, Satan was disarmed as an accuser of people before God because of the sacrifice of Christ so legally. Satan was judged and disarmed was going to truth matters with Dr. Cheryl Davis matters is a ministry project-based ministry teaching sound theology goes inside or outside of the church.

Truth matters is a ministry project-based ministry teaching sound theology goes inside or outside of the church.

